
Jean Cocteau, his adopted son Edouard Dermit and photographer Jacques-Henri with a not yet identified lady. Vallauris 1955.
In the strong sunlight of Vallauris in 1955, Jean Cocteau leans in to examine a folder of papers held by his adopted son, Edouard Dermit. Dressed in a dark shirt and patterned ascot, Dermit stands at the center of the group. To their left, photographer Jacques-Henri peers over Cocteau’s shoulder, while an unidentified woman to the right, wearing sunglasses on her head, holds a large line drawing of a face.
